Maximizing Online Presence: Digital Marketing Agency for Law Firms

In today’s digital age, having a robust online presence is not merely an option for law firms; it is a necessity. The legal landscape has evolved significantly, with potential clients increasingly turning to the internet to seek legal advice and services. According to a survey conducted by the American Bar Association, approximately 70% of individuals seeking legal assistance begin their search online.

This statistic underscores the critical need for law firms to establish a strong digital footprint. A well-crafted online presence not only enhances visibility but also builds credibility and trust among prospective clients. Moreover, an effective online presence allows law firms to showcase their expertise and differentiate themselves from competitors.

By leveraging various digital platforms, firms can highlight their areas of specialization, share client testimonials, and provide valuable resources that address common legal questions. This not only positions the firm as a thought leader in its field but also fosters a sense of connection with potential clients who may be navigating complex legal issues. In essence, a strategic online presence serves as a powerful tool for attracting and retaining clients in an increasingly competitive market.

Choosing the Right Digital Marketing Agency

Selecting the right digital marketing agency is a pivotal step for law firms aiming to enhance their online presence. The agency should possess a deep understanding of the legal industry and its unique challenges. A firm that specializes in legal marketing will be more adept at crafting tailored strategies that resonate with the target audience.

When evaluating potential agencies, law firms should consider their track record, client testimonials, and case studies that demonstrate successful campaigns within the legal sector. Additionally, it is essential to assess the agency’s approach to communication and collaboration. A successful partnership hinges on transparency and alignment of goals.

Law firms should seek agencies that prioritize regular updates and are willing to adapt strategies based on performance metrics. Furthermore, understanding the agency’s pricing structure and the services included in their packages is crucial. A comprehensive digital marketing strategy may encompass SEO, content creation, social media management, and PPC advertising, all of which should be clearly outlined in the agency’s proposal.

Creating a Strong and Professional Website

A law firm’s website serves as its digital storefront, making it imperative that it conveys professionalism and trustworthiness. The design should be clean, intuitive, and user-friendly, allowing visitors to navigate easily and find the information they need without frustration. Key elements such as clear calls-to-action (CTAs), contact information, and practice area descriptions should be prominently displayed.

Additionally, incorporating client testimonials and case results can significantly enhance credibility and encourage potential clients to reach out. Beyond aesthetics, the website must also be optimized for mobile devices. With an increasing number of users accessing websites via smartphones and tablets, a responsive design is essential for providing a seamless experience across all devices.

Furthermore, loading speed is a critical factor; research indicates that users are likely to abandon a site if it takes more than three seconds to load. Therefore, law firms should prioritize website performance by optimizing images, leveraging browser caching, and minimizing code bloat.

Utilizing Search Engine Optimization (SEO) Strategies

Search Engine Optimization (SEO) is a fundamental component of any digital marketing strategy for law firms. By optimizing their website for search engines, firms can improve their visibility in search results, making it easier for potential clients to find them. Effective SEO strategies involve keyword research to identify terms that prospective clients are using when searching for legal services.

For instance, a family law firm might target keywords such as “divorce attorney” or “child custody lawyer” to attract relevant traffic. On-page SEO techniques are equally important; these include optimizing title tags, meta descriptions, header tags, and content with targeted keywords while ensuring that the content remains informative and engaging. Additionally, off-page SEO strategies such as building high-quality backlinks from reputable websites can significantly enhance a firm’s authority in the eyes of search engines.

Regularly updating content through blog posts or articles can also signal to search engines that the website is active and relevant, further boosting its ranking potential.

Engaging with Potential Clients through Social Media Marketing

Social media platforms have emerged as powerful tools for law firms to engage with potential clients and build relationships. By establishing a presence on platforms such as Facebook, LinkedIn, Twitter, and Instagram, firms can share valuable content, interact with followers, and showcase their expertise in real-time. For example, a personal injury law firm might share success stories or tips on navigating insurance claims, providing followers with useful information while subtly promoting their services.

Moreover, social media allows for targeted advertising opportunities that can reach specific demographics based on location, interests, and behaviors. This targeted approach ensures that marketing efforts are directed toward individuals who are more likely to require legal assistance. Engaging with followers through comments and direct messages fosters a sense of community and trust, encouraging potential clients to reach out when they need legal help.

Implementing Pay-Per-Click (PPC) Advertising

Pay-Per-Click (PPC) advertising is an effective way for law firms to gain immediate visibility in search engine results. Unlike organic SEO efforts that may take time to yield results, PPC campaigns can drive traffic to a firm’s website almost instantly. By bidding on relevant keywords related to their practice areas, law firms can ensure that their ads appear at the top of search results when potential clients are actively seeking legal services.

A well-structured PPC campaign involves careful keyword selection, ad copywriting that highlights unique selling propositions, and landing pages designed to convert visitors into leads. For instance, a criminal defense attorney might create ads targeting keywords like “DUI lawyer” or “criminal defense attorney near me,” directing users to a landing page that outlines their services and includes a strong call-to-action. Additionally, monitoring campaign performance through analytics tools allows firms to make data-driven adjustments to optimize their return on investment.

Generating Quality Content through Blogging and Email Marketing

Content marketing plays a crucial role in establishing authority and attracting potential clients to law firms. By creating informative blog posts that address common legal questions or provide insights into recent legal developments, firms can position themselves as knowledgeable resources in their respective fields. For example, an estate planning attorney might write articles about the importance of wills and trusts or provide guidance on navigating probate processes.

Email marketing complements content generation by allowing law firms to nurture leads over time. By building an email list through website sign-ups or social media engagement, firms can send regular newsletters featuring blog highlights, legal tips, or updates about their services. This consistent communication keeps the firm top-of-mind for potential clients who may not be ready to engage immediately but appreciate receiving valuable information.

Monitoring and Analyzing Online Performance for Continuous Improvement

To ensure the effectiveness of digital marketing efforts, law firms must prioritize monitoring and analyzing their online performance regularly. Utilizing tools such as Google Analytics provides valuable insights into website traffic patterns, user behavior, and conversion rates. By understanding which pages attract the most visitors or where users drop off in the conversion process, firms can make informed decisions about optimizing their website and marketing strategies.

Additionally, tracking key performance indicators (KPIs) such as lead generation rates from PPC campaigns or engagement metrics from social media posts allows firms to assess the success of their initiatives. Regularly reviewing these metrics enables law firms to identify areas for improvement and adapt their strategies accordingly. For instance, if a particular blog post generates significant traffic but few conversions, it may indicate a need for stronger CTAs or additional follow-up content that guides readers toward taking action.
